Job Description:

Taboola is seeking a dynamic Country Manager for Japan to lead our growth, strengthen our reputation, and build a strong, people-centric culture in the region. This role calls for an experienced sales leader with a deep understanding of the Japanese ad-tech landscape, capable of designing and executing bold strategies while fostering collaboration across diverse teams. The Country Manager will play a pivotal role in expanding Taboola’s business and operations in Japan by creating impactful sales strategies, defining a clear road map, building meaningful partnerships, and driving revenue growth. We are looking for a leader who can execute quickly, operate independently, and isn’t afraid to get their hands dirty while fostering collaboration across diverse teams. The Country Manager of Taboola Japan must possess a strong drive to consistently achieve double-digit annual growth, demonstrating unwavering focus on scaling the business and delivering exceptional results year after year.

Job Responsibility:

  • Develop and execute a tailored strategy to expand Taboola’s advertiser and publisher business in Japan
  • Generate new business, manage a robust pipeline, and accurately forecast growth
  • Build strategic partnerships with key stakeholders, aligning them with a coherent product strategy
  • Close deals with publishers and advertisers, while proactively identifying new market opportunities
  • Innovate in deal structuring and collaborate with internal teams to support seamless implementation
  • Represent Taboola at industry events, trade shows, and roadshows to drive brand preference and loyalty
  • Build relationships with key local partners, including advertisers, publishers, and agencies
  • Provide insights to the product team to shape product development based on client needs
  • Lead and motivate a high-performing sales organization, fostering collaboration and a growth mindset
  • Cultivate a people-centric culture that emphasizes development and shared success
  • Manage cross-functional teams effectively, ensuring alignment with Taboola’s global goals and Japan’s market-specific needs

Requirements:

  • Japan Market Expertise: Proven track record in the Japanese ad-tech industry with 5+ years of experience and exceptional knowledge of the local advertiser, publisher, and revenue ecosystem
  • Sales & Leadership Experience: 10+ years in key sales positions, including managing large teams or organizations of 30+ people, with strong leadership skills and deep familiarity with the business environment in Japan
  • Strategic Visionary: Ability to design a comprehensive and sustainable business model tailored to Japan’s unique growth opportunities
  • Client-Focused Relationship Builder: Skilled in developing long-lasting relationships with top advertisers, publishers, and agencies, leveraging deep local market understanding
  • Operational Leader: Experience as a Representative Director (or equivalent senior position) overseeing operations, including sales strategies, trade shows, and quality initiatives
  • Technologically Savvy: Expertise in digital advertising, video, and ad-tech systems, with the ability to explain product benefits within this context
  • Cultural Awareness: Sensitivity toward cultural differences and fluency in both Japanese and English
  • Hands-On Approach: A proactive and results-oriented attitude, with the ability to take ownership, drive initiatives to completion, and adapt quickly to challenges. Demonstrates a willingness to be deeply involved in operational and strategic tasks to achieve business objectives
  • Growth-Oriented Mindset: Strong drive to achieve double-digit year-over-year business growth, with a focus on scaling the organization and driving results rather than solely managing an established team
What we offer:
  • Well-being: Enjoy a range of locally specific benefits
  • Flexibility: We offer a hybrid work schedule with 3 days in-office with an option to come in more often if desired
  • Work with some of the biggest names: Our publisher partners include Yahoo, Conde Nast, Fox Sports, NBCU, ESPN, CBS, and E! Online. Our advertiser clients include Wells Fargo, Honda, Pinterest, and Expedia
